Glen Campbell, Pennsylvania


 

Glen Campbell is a borough located in Indiana County, Pennsylvania. As of the 2000 census, the borough had a total population of 306. The borough was named in 1889 for Cornelius Campbell, the first superintendent of the Glenwood Coal Company, which mined in that area, not for the modern singer Glen Campbell.
